Linda Nicholson and Scottish Borders Council [2014] ScotIC 148_2014 (08 July 2014)
The Council failed to comply with section 10(1) of the Freedom of Information (Scotland) Act 2002 by not responding to the applicant's request within the statutory timescale.

Legal Issues
- 1 Whether Scottish Borders Council failed to respond to a request for information within statutory timescales under the Freedom of Information (Scotland) Act 2002
Ratio Decidendi
The Council failed to comply with section 10(1) of the Freedom of Information (Scotland) Act 2002 by not responding to the applicant's request within the statutory timescale.
Court Disposition
Request upheld
Orders
- The Council is required to respond to the applicant's request in accordance with Part 1 of FOISA, by issuing a notice under section 21(1) of FOISA or providing the information requested, within 35 days of the date of this decision.
